There are currently three (official) albums that My Chemical Romance has come out with now. A fourth should come out in 2010. The first is titled "I Brought You My Bullets, You Brought Me Your Love", in 2002. In 2004, they came out with "Three Cheers For Sweet Revenge". In 2006 they came out with "The Black Parade". A later, unofficial album of 4 hit singles preformed live in Mexico City in 2008. This was called "The Black Parade Is Dead!".

there oldest video is Vampire's will never hurt you which is from their first album then from their next album Three Cheers for Sweet Revenge there is I'm Not Okay, Helena, and The Ghost of You. Then from The Black Parade there is Welcome to the Black Parade, Famous Last Words (my personal favorite), Dead!, Teenagers, and I Don't Love You. They also have Desolation Row from the movie Watchmen. From their new album Danger Days there is Na Na Na, and now Sing is their newest one.
